What GPA do you need to get into JWU? ›
Undergraduate students need a minimum GPA of 2.0. Accelerated Bachelor of Science in Nursing students need a minimum GPA of 3.0 and must earn grades of B/80 or higher in each course.

Do Johnson and Wales look at SAT scores? ›
Does JWU require SAT/ACT scores or SAT Essay/ACT Writing? No, the submission of standardized test scores (SAT, ACT) or SAT Essay/ACT Writing is optional and students who do not submit scores will not be disadvantaged in the review process.

What is Johnson and Wales university Charlotte ranked? ›
Johnson & Wales University—Charlotte's ranking in the 2024 edition of Best Colleges is Regional Colleges South, #24. Its tuition and fees are $39,992. Johnson & Wales University—Charlotte is a private institution.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 1,140 (fall 2022), and the setting is Urban.

What is Johnson and Wales known for? ›
An innovative educational leader, the university offers undergraduate and graduate degree programs in arts and sciences, business, engineering, food innovation, hospitality, nutrition, health and wellness. It also offers undergraduate programs in culinary arts, dietetics and design.
